Pink clay. Camassia

100% natural sun-dried pink clay "Illite, Kaolinite" with a very fine grain size for making face masks.

  • 100% natural pink clay with a particularly fine grain size (75 microns) for making face masks.
  • Clays are a natural source of minerals and trace elements for our skin. Pink clay (Illite, Kaolinite) is of high purity and quality for making homemade face masks, scrubs or facial cleansing gels. It is suitable for normal and sensitive skin.
  • Superfine pink clay, non-irradiated (non-ionised), without preservatives or other treatments, free of allergens, free of nanoparticles and free of genetically modified organisms.
  • Origin: France

Ingredients

  • INCI: Kaolin (white clay) – Illite (Red Clay)
  • Particle size: 75 micrometres (µm)
  • Mineralogical analysis: Illite, Montmorillonite, Kaolinite, quartz
  • *Not certified for food use

How to use

Can be used as a natural colourant in homemade soaps - (Dosage: from 1 teaspoon to 1 tablespoon of clay per 1000g of soap).

  • Homemade face mask. Put 2 to 3 tablespoons of clay in a bowl and add a little water or hydrolate. Leave to stand for a few minutes, then mix with a small spatula until you obtain a creamy paste. Apply a thick layer to the face, leaving the eye area free. Leave the mask on for about 10 minutes, but do not let it dry out. Rinse with warm water, dry the skin and apply a moisturising cream.
  • Homemade hair mask. Put 2 to 3 tablespoons of clay in a bowl and add a little water or hydrolate. Leave to stand for a few minutes, then mix with a small spatula until you obtain a creamy paste. Spread the paste over the entire scalp and leave on for 10 to 15 minutes. Rinse and use shampoo.
  • In the bath. Add 200g of clay to the bath water. Take a 20-minute bath. Rinse.
  • Clays can also be used in the form of compresses.

Quantitative composition

  • (SiO2) 64.85%
  • (Al2O3) 23.50%
  • (MgO) 0.50%
  • (Fe₂O₃) 4.35%
  • (TiO₂) 0.07%
  • (Na₂O) 0.10%
  • (CaO) 0.55%
